Although the chemical formula's of all alps are very similar there are two very important characteristics to alps that are important to know and research.

1. time of onset or kick in time....this can vary from brand to brand, but not by very much.....an hour's difference does exist between some brands. To quote: "Alprazolam has a fast onset of action and symptomatic relief. Ninety percent of peak effects are achieved within the first hour of using either the CT formulation or the XR formulation in preparation for panic disorder, and full peak effects are achieved in 1.5 and 1.6 hours respectively."

2. the 1/2 life.......this is the time ( in terms of hours) the med remains in your body (just double the 1/2 life to get the full reading on how long the med is in your system). This is a whole different matter, because the variance in time the med is in your body between alps can be HUGE. For example: the 1/2 life of Xanax is between 6-20 hours, the 1/2 life of Clonazepam (Rivotril) is between 18-39 hours.....that's a long time.....leading to a build up of this med in your body......and may not be healthy.
